“There really isn't much to this...it's some relatively thin fleece...which will have pros and cons. It is NOT windstopper fleece, so it isn't going to keep all air flow from chilling your head. However, it will be good for preventing your head from overheating and the design covers your ears and the back of your neck nicely. It is very soft fabric...perhaps not the most durable fleece out there, but also not the most expensive.If you are looking for a super technical fancy helmet liner like something [@]or [@] would make, keep looking. If you are looking for a simple helmet liner that fits snug, will work for 90% of all cold weather riding conditions and costs about $5, then pick one of these up.”
